
Yogurt Dill Dip for Salmon

Ingredients
- 1 - lemon
- 1 clove - garlic
- 1 cup - full-fat Greek yogurt
- 4 tablespoons - fresh dill
- 1 tbsp - olive oil
- 1 tsp - honey
- ¼ tsp - kosher salt
- ⅛ tsp - black pepper
Instructions
- In a small bowl, mix together 1 cup of Greek yogurt, the zest and juice of 1 lemon, 1 grated garlic clove, 4 tablespoons of fresh dill, 1 tablespoon of olive oil, 1 teaspoon of honey, ¼ teaspoon of kosher salt, and ⅛ teaspoon of black pepper.
- Stir well until all ingredients are fully incorporated.
- Chill in the fridge for 10-15 minutes before serving.
